js怎么设置域名
温馨提示:这篇文章已超过111天没有更新,请注意相关的内容是否还可用!
🌐 JS如何设置域名详解 🌐
在当今的互联网时代,域名已经成为网站不可或缺的一部分,而JavaScript(简称JS)作为前端开发的重要工具,自然也离不开域名的设置,JS如何设置域名呢?下面,我们就来详细探讨一下这个问题。
我们需要了解什么是域名,域名是互联网上用于标识网站的一组字符,www.example.com,而JS设置域名,主要是指在前端页面中,如何正确地引用和访问对应的域名资源。
以下是一些常见的JS设置域名的场景和解决方案:
静态资源引用:在HTML页面中,我们需要引用CSS、JavaScript等静态资源,这时,可以通过以下方式设置域名:
<link rel="stylesheet" href="https://www.example.com/css/style.css"><script src="https://www.example.com/js/app.js"></script>
我们直接将域名写在了URL中,这样浏览器就会自动去对应的域名下加载资源。
动态设置域名:在实际开发中,有时我们需要根据不同的情况动态设置域名,这时,可以使用JavaScript的
window.location对象来实现:
对象来实现:
var domain = 'https://www.example.com';window.location.href = domain + '/index.html';
在这段代码中,我们首先定义了一个变量
domain,用来存储域名,通过
window.location.href将域名与路径拼接,实现页面跳转。
将域名与路径拼接,实现页面跳转。
跨域请求:在JavaScript中,由于同源策略的限制,我们无法直接向不同域名的服务器发送请求,这时,可以通过以下方式实现跨域请求:
- CORS(跨源资源共享):在服务器端设置响应头
Access-Control-Allow-Origin,允许跨域访问。
- ,允许跨域访问。
- JSONP(JSON with Padding):利用
- 标签的跨域特性,发送GET请求。
- 代理服务器:在本地搭建一个代理服务器,将请求转发到目标域名。
- 使用本地服务器:在本地搭建一个简单的服务器,如使用Node.js的
http-server模块。
- 模块。
- 修改hosts文件:在Windows系统中,将本地IP地址与域名对应起来,实现本地访问。
<script>标签的跨域特性,发送GET请求。
本地开发环境:在本地开发过程中,我们通常需要将JS代码部署到本地服务器,这时,可以通过以下方式设置域名:
JS设置域名的方法有很多,具体使用哪种方法取决于实际需求,希望本文能帮助大家更好地理解JS设置域名的相关知识。🌟
- CORS(跨源资源共享):在服务器端设置响应头
The End
发布于:2025-07-20,除非注明,否则均为原创文章,转载请注明出处。